Considering replacement your glazing? Dual pane windows offers a host of advantages , including reduced energy bills , better noise reduction , and increased home price. However, there are associated expenses. The initial cost can vary widely depending on the size of your apertures , the kind of frame (PVC, wood, aluminum), and the complexity of the replacement. A typical unit could be priced anywhere from £300 to £800 , including labor . Installation usually involves removing the existing window frame , installing the new double glazed window , and securing it properly. While DIY kits are available, professional fitting is generally recommended to ensure a airtight fit and void any warranty issues. Be sure to get multiple estimates from reputable installers before making a choice .

Choosing Double-paned Windows vs. Single – Which is Right for Your Home?
When it comes to upgrading your home's insulation , the choice between double-paned and single windows can feel quite overwhelming. Single windows offer a basic solution, but they miss the considerable benefits provided by their double-paned counterparts. Twin-glazed windows consist of two panes of glass with a pocket of air or gas – typically argon – trapped between them, significantly lessening heat transfer. This results in a noticeable decrease in heating and cooling bills throughout the year. Furthermore, they offer better sound insulation, creating a more quiet living environment. Here's a quick comparison:
- Single Windows: Give minimal insulation; cheaper upfront cost but higher long-term energy bills.
- Double Glazed Windows: Superior insulation; higher initial investment, but yield substantial savings over time and contribute to a more comfortable home.
Ultimately, the best choice depends on your individual needs and budget. Consider the climate you live in and how much value you place on energy savings and noise reduction when making your choice .
